Rob-dependent caffeine-micFp interaction underlies species-specific antibiotic antagonisms in <i>E. coli.</i>
Published 2025“…Caffeine triggers expression of MicF small RNA in a Rob-dependent manner, which then binds to the 5′-UTR of <i>ompF</i> mRNA to inhibit and decrease OmpF protein levels. …”

DataSheet_1_Response of harbor porpoises (Phocoena phocoena) to different types of acoustic harassment devices and subsequent piling during the construction of offshore wind farms....
Published 2023“…Between March 2018 and April 2019, harbor porpoise detection rates were monitored acoustically in four offshore wind farm projects using CPODs before, during and after piling at different distances up to 10 km from piling. APD operation led to a significant decrease in detection rates in the vicinity of the device, indicating the displacement of the animals from a small-scale area. …”
